Development #68063
Cellule contenu d'une fiche: avoir une option pour présenter les fiches en "carte" ou en "tableau"
0%
Description
Affichage en "carte": affichage actuel
Affichage en "tableau": affichage de la cellule "Fiches" (liste de liens)
Fichiers
Révisions associées
tests: move wcs tests (#68063)
tests: split wcs tests (#68063)
tests: rename card cell tests with card display mode (#68063)
wcs: rename cards context variable (#68063)
It can conflict with Cards context object from
publik-django-templatetags
wcs: render card cell with table mode (#68063)
wcs: fix custom_title update (#68063)
wcs: card cell with table mode can use cards cell assets (#68063)
Historique
Mis à jour par Lauréline Guérin il y a plus d'un an
- Fichier 0008-wcs-card-cell-with-table-mode-can-use-cards-cell-ass.patch 0008-wcs-card-cell-with-table-mode-can-use-cards-cell-ass.patch ajouté
- Fichier 0007-wcs-fix-custom_title-update-68063.patch 0007-wcs-fix-custom_title-update-68063.patch ajouté
- Fichier 0006-wcs-render-card-cell-with-table-mode-68063.patch 0006-wcs-render-card-cell-with-table-mode-68063.patch ajouté
- Fichier 0005-wcs-rename-cards-context-variable-68063.patch 0005-wcs-rename-cards-context-variable-68063.patch ajouté
- Fichier 0004-tests-rename-card-cell-tests-with-card-display-mode-.patch 0004-tests-rename-card-cell-tests-with-card-display-mode-.patch ajouté
- Fichier 0003-tests-split-wcs-tests-68063.patch 0003-tests-split-wcs-tests-68063.patch ajouté
- Fichier 0002-tests-move-wcs-tests-68063.patch 0002-tests-move-wcs-tests-68063.patch ajouté
- Fichier 0001-wcs-add-display_mode-option-for-card-cell-68063.patch 0001-wcs-add-display_mode-option-for-card-cell-68063.patch ajouté
- Statut changé de Nouveau à Solution proposée
- Patch proposed changé de Non à Oui
0001: configuration de la cellule (j'ai rangé les options d'affichage - pagination, mode, customisation - dans un onglet "Display")
0002: déplacement des tests wcs, en vue d'un split
0003: split
0004: renommage des tests cellule fiche spécifiques au mode "carte"
0005: renommage d'une variable dans le contexte de rendu de la cellule fiches, pour éviter le conflit avec l'object cards
(filtres de requête)
0006: le dev (j'ai fait attention à limiter les call à wcs dans le cas d'un affichage en mode tableau, tout est fait lors du rendu de la cellule en ajax)
0007: au passage, un fix pour cleaner custom_title lorsque title_type n'est pas "manual" (sinon l'onglet reste marqué comme "modifié", si on passe de "manual" avec un custom title à "auto")
0008: gestion des assets, une cellule fiche en mode "tableau" récupère les assets définis sur la cellule fiches
basé sur #68037
Mis à jour par Lauréline Guérin il y a plus d'un an
Mis à jour par Lauréline Guérin il y a plus d'un an
Mis à jour par Frédéric Péters il y a plus d'un an
- Statut changé de Solution proposée à Solution validée
Pour moi ok ainsi.
Mis à jour par Lauréline Guérin il y a plus d'un an
- Statut changé de Solution validée à Résolu (à déployer)
commit 0712cbe5d60091100d565bba023c76337a7cce26 Author: Lauréline Guérin <zebuline@entrouvert.com> Date: Fri Aug 12 09:41:28 2022 +0200 wcs: card cell with table mode can use cards cell assets (#68063) commit 5a1f1a9a51311f73edad5761cfdde1ffa2f37184 Author: Lauréline Guérin <zebuline@entrouvert.com> Date: Thu Aug 11 21:28:06 2022 +0200 wcs: fix custom_title update (#68063) commit 7716113a51160e5611db1c9667c8c566ab72673f Author: Lauréline Guérin <zebuline@entrouvert.com> Date: Thu Aug 11 16:46:26 2022 +0200 wcs: render card cell with table mode (#68063) commit fed5465f981e90afc06dcec224aa48ad7f9cb2dd Author: Lauréline Guérin <zebuline@entrouvert.com> Date: Thu Aug 11 14:23:41 2022 +0200 wcs: rename cards context variable (#68063) It can conflict with Cards context object from publik-django-templatetags commit 411170695f47d1f2d2b223b5836fdf99dc261c29 Author: Lauréline Guérin <zebuline@entrouvert.com> Date: Thu Aug 11 14:09:37 2022 +0200 tests: rename card cell tests with card display mode (#68063) commit eca53776fb3e74c65c667f70bb702899ce5b5e61 Author: Lauréline Guérin <zebuline@entrouvert.com> Date: Thu Aug 11 14:01:57 2022 +0200 tests: split wcs tests (#68063) commit 05d189762728e6ed9c90b1f57896c85b0b7ef70b Author: Lauréline Guérin <zebuline@entrouvert.com> Date: Thu Aug 11 13:51:28 2022 +0200 tests: move wcs tests (#68063) commit c832299962a68f288568cdf7052b340dd3740934 Author: Lauréline Guérin <zebuline@entrouvert.com> Date: Thu Aug 11 11:22:37 2022 +0200 wcs: add display_mode option for card cell (#68063)
Mis à jour par Transition automatique il y a plus d'un an
- Statut changé de Résolu (à déployer) à Solution déployée
wcs: add display_mode option for card cell (#68063)